7oceans Launches Alliance to Transform Global M&A Strategies

Introducing 7oceans: A Game Changer in Mergers and Acquisitions
A dynamic shift has occurred in the realm of mergers and acquisitions, marking the arrival of 7oceans, a pioneering international alliance uniting esteemed advisory firms renowned for their expertise. This innovative collaboration aims to enhance M&A transactions by bridging geographical barriers and fostering a more connected global marketplace.
The Vision Behind 7oceans
7oceans is not just an alliance; it represents a vision for a smarter, more collaborative approach to M&A. The alliance is designed to streamline the identification of potential buyers and suitable target companies, effectively leveraging the local insights of its members to create global impact. Each member firm operates independently, maintaining its unique identity while benefiting from the collective strength of the alliance.
Who Are the Founding Members?
The alliance is comprised of several founding members, including Taurus Advisory, Provantage, Adviso, Nash Advisory, Stepstone Corporate Finance+, Ramus & Company, and CKS Finance. Each firm brings a wealth of experience and knowledge from their respective markets, enriching the 7oceans network. As the alliance grows, it seeks to incorporate ambitious advisory firms from various continents, including North America, Asia, Latin America, the Middle East, and Africa, thereby expanding its horizons and enhancing its service offerings.
The Power of Collaboration
The strength of 7oceans lies in its member firms' ability to collaborate effectively. They are already showcasing their commitment through regular deal discussions, shared databases, and collaborative pitches. These efforts culminate in bi-annual global conferences, where members convene to strategize and discuss trends in cross-border transactions. This cooperative spirit is expected to lead to enhanced efficiency and quicker deal closures, ultimately benefiting clients.
